How can companies ensure that gamification techniques in remote customer experience rituals are inclusive and accessible to customers of all backgrounds and abilities?
Companies can ensure that gamification techniques in remote customer experience rituals are inclusive and accessible by designing games that are easy to understand and navigate for customers of all backgrounds and abilities. They should provide multiple options for participation, such as different levels of difficulty or alternative ways to interact with the game. Companies should also ensure that the games are accessible to customers with disabilities by incorporating features such as screen reader compatibility or customizable controls. Additionally, companies should gather feedback from a diverse group of customers to continuously improve and make adjustments to the gamification techniques to ensure inclusivity.
